单选题

有两个字符数组a,b,则以下正确的输入语句是()。

Agets(a,b);

Bscanf(“%s%s”,a,b);

Cscanf(“%s%s”,&a,&b);

Dgets(“a”),gets(“b”);

正确答案

来源:www.examk.com

答案解析

相似试题
  • 有字符数组定义如下,则不能比较a,b两个字符串大小的表达式是()。

    单选题查看答案

  • 编写一个函数,将字符数组a中的全部字符复制到字符数组b中. 不要使用strcpy函数. 主函数输入任意一个字符串,调该函数,复制出另一个字符串。将两个串输出。

    简答题查看答案

  • 已知charx[]=hello,y[]={’h’,’e’,’a’,’b’,’e’};,则关于两个数组长度的正确描述是().

    单选题查看答案

  • 设二个数组为A[0‥7]、B[-5‥2,3‥8],则这两个数组分别能存放的字符的最大个数是()。

    单选题查看答案

  • 字符串是以()为结束标志的一维字符数组。有定义:char a[]=””;则a数组的长度是()。

    填空题查看答案

  • 若有定义:intx,y;chara,b,c;并有以下输入数据(此处<CR>代表换行,代表空格):12<CR>ABC<CR>>则能给X赋整数1,给Y赋数2,给a赋字符A,给b赋字符B,给c赋字符C的正确程序段是()

    单选题查看答案

  • 若有定义:intx,y;chara,b,c;并有以下输入数据(此处代表换行符,/u代表空格):6/u2A/uB/uC则能给x赋整数6,给y赋整数2,给a赋字符A,给b赋字符B,给c赋字符C的正确程序段是()

    单选题查看答案

  • 以下程序是将字符串b的内容连接字符数组a的内容后面,形成新字符串a,请填(2)空使程序完整。

    填空题查看答案

  • 分别将a、b所指字符串中字符倒序,然后按排列的顺序交叉合并到c所指数组中,过长的剩余字符接在c所指数组的尾部。例如:当a所指字符串中的内容为:"abcdefg",b所指字符串中的内容为:"1234"时,则c所指数组中的内容应该为:"g4f3e2d1cba";

    简答题查看答案